What is National Friendship Day?

National Friendship Day is a day that is set aside to celebrate the bonds of friendship. It is celebrated annually on the first Sunday in August. This day provides an opportunity for people to show their appreciation for their friends and to make new friends.

National Friendship Day was first established in 1930 by Joyce Hall, the founder of Hallmark Cards. Hall came up with the idea for the day after observing how people were using greeting cards to express their affection for one another. She thought that it would be nice to have a special day dedicated to friendship.

The History of National Friendship Day

National Friendship Day has been celebrated on the first Sunday of August since 1930. The day was created by Joyce Hall, the founder of Hallmark cards, as a way to encourage people to send cards to their friends.

The idea for National Friendship Day came from a similar event that is celebrated in Argentina. In Argentina, the day is called “Dia del Amigo” and it is celebrated on July 20th. Hallmark decided to create National Friendship Day so that people in the United States could have their own special day to celebrate friendship.
